    Well, I changed over a few of my ads and am not happy at all. The video ads that are showing up are totally unrelated and they are making my site look trashy. On my wedding site, I have video ads for chemo therapy and cadilac. Should I give it a few days to see if the ads become more relevant. The text ads are still relavent so I am concerned that they just don't have any video or box ads to go with my theme. I think it really looks bad.

    I think I may have to put these down at the bottom of the page and leave the text ads on top. I'm sure a cadilac ad would pay well but it just looks horrible. I will do this for a while to see if the video ads become more relavent.
